Re: Alcohol and Carrying Question
.08 is the legal definition of imparement
. If you can't pass a field sobriety test
you are impared regardless of your BAC. If you are deemed impared the nice officer will invite you to a sleep over at the local jail. So, if you drink don't drive and dont carry a firearm you'll stay out of trouble that way.
